Biosketch
Dr. Thornbury began his medical education at the University of Kentucky, graduating from the College of Pharmacy with an Honors Program distinction. He practiced five years in the rural Appalachian mountains of Virginia before returning to study medicine at the University of Louisville, where he graduated and completed work with Harvard Medical School at The Cambridge Hospital in Cambridge, Massachusetts.
He has practiced medicine for fifteen years with expertise in family and internal medicine. His clinical research interests involve Mobile E-Visit technology, in particular, its use in dissimilar populations. Dr. Thornbury’s academic interests involve Lean Organizational Health Systems with emphasis in its application in outpatient clinics, as well as, educating medical professionals in True Lean Systems.
Dr. Thornbury is the Founder of Me-Visit, a company pledged to help pioneer solutions to improve healthcare delivery and help end medical homelessness. He is CEO and Medical Director of Medical Associates Clinic in Glasgow.
